Role description
Title: Quality Assurance (Custom Web application – Order Management) Location: Arden Hills MN Job Type: Hybrid Contract Duration: 6 months Send your resumes at hr@irow9.com Visit our website www.irow9.com/careers for more positions. • Quality Assurance candidate with 5 years of manual and automated testing experience in Custom Web application – Order Management or e-commerce platform or SAP Commerce Cloud – Hybris or Salesforce Order Management or Blue Yonder - JDA or Magento – Adobe commerce Or Oracle Order Management or IBM Sterling • Candidate must be a self-starter and able to work independently. • Must review User stories, use cases, User Design, Functional and Technical requirement documents to ensure requirements are testable. • Write detailed, comprehensive, and well-structured test scenarios, test plans, test cases and test schedule. • Test cases must be written and executed to cover Black box, Functional, integration, non-functional, UI, Smoke, Sanity and regression scenarios. • Extensive knowledge and experience in developing automation scripts using tool - Playwright • Manage, coordinate, and execute all required testing activates in accordance to test plan. • Hands on experience with Structured Query Language (SQL). Must be comfortable writing medium to complex queries to extract and analyze data. • Record defects by clearly articulating and defining each issue. Coordinate with Product Delivery Lead/ scrum master and Business System Analyst to identify appropriate resources to ensure resolution. • Comfortable with effort estimation based on the high-level requirements. • Identify testing risks and provide mitigation plans to minimize risks. • Experience in conducting Demo and User Acceptance Testing with business. • Experience working with development and Business Analyst teams to meet the milestones. Must be able collaborate with other QAs in the team. • Experience in Agile able to collaborate/ team player, excellent written and oral communication, take ownership and comfortable in a dynamic environment. • Tools/ Technology – o TypeScript, SQL, SOAP/ POSTMAN, XML, JSON, Mural, Visio, Excel etc. • Verify that end-user experience meets expectations during testing as well as post-implementation. • Identify and recommend improvements to enhance the Product. • Participate in daily stand-ups to communicate testing progress and status. • Take Ownership, good spoken and written communication skill, effectively collaborate with the team, ability to adapt. • Nice to have - o Experience in Microsoft DevOps. o Experience in integrating the Custom web order management application with back-end application like ERP (JDE preferred) • This is a summary, not an all-inclusive description of job duties. Other job duties and responsibilities may also be assigned by Product Manager/ Product Delivery Lead at any time based upon business priorities and team needs. • This position is based out of Minneapolis and candidates are expected at office three days a week.
